dd-trace-py
dd-trace-py copied to clipboard
feat(internal): span sampling file config envar (backport #4042)
This is an automatic backport of pull request #4042 done by Mergify. Cherry-pick of c0e9a9bc3a355c41634d8958a41893b33050d683 has failed:
On branch mergify/bp/1.4/pr-4042
Your branch is up to date with 'origin/1.4'.
You are currently cherry-picking commit c0e9a9bc.
(fix conflicts and run "git cherry-pick --continue")
(use "git cherry-pick --skip" to skip this patch)
(use "git cherry-pick --abort" to cancel the cherry-pick operation)
Changes to be committed:
modified: ddtrace/constants.py
Unmerged paths:
(use "git add/rm <file>..." as appropriate to mark resolution)
both modified: ddtrace/internal/sampling.py
deleted by us: tests/tracer/test_single_span_sampling_rules.py
To fix up this pull request, you can check it out locally. See documentation: https://docs.github.com/en/github/collaborating-with-pull-requests/reviewing-changes-in-pull-requests/checking-out-pull-requests-locally
Mergify commands and options
More conditions and actions can be found in the documentation.
You can also trigger Mergify actions by commenting on this pull request:
@Mergifyio refreshwill re-evaluate the rules@Mergifyio rebasewill rebase this PR on its base branch@Mergifyio updatewill merge the base branch into this PR@Mergifyio backport <destination>will backport this PR on<destination>branch
Additionally, on Mergify dashboard you can:
- look at your merge queues
- generate the Mergify configuration with the config editor.
Finally, you can contact us on https://mergify.com